Product Details
PAD Contact and Double Ended Wire with Contacts
820-1740 is a PAD Series socket contact manufactured from Phosphor Bronze and Tin plated for wire size 0.13∼0.33 mm² (26∼22 AWG) with an insulation diameter of 1.0∼1.5 mm.
PAD Series Cable Assemblies have SPH-001T-P0.5L contacts crimped on both ends for use in PADP Series Receptacle Housings, see stock number 820-1728 typical.
820-1743 is 150 mm long.
820-1747 is 300 mm long.

2.0mm JST PAD Connector
The 2.0mm PAD Series Wire-to-Board Connectors from JST are dual row for high density applications and provide: secure locking, polarization, an insertion guide and reliable contacts with long dimples for continuity under adverse conditions.
Specifications
Attribute | Value |
---|---|
Gender | Female |
For Use With | PAD Connector Housing |
Series | PAD |
Minimum Wire Size mm² | 0.1mm² |
Maximum Wire Size mm² | 0.3mm² |
Termination Method | Crimp |
Contact Plating | Tin |
Minimum Wire Size AWG | 26AWG |
Contact Material | Phosphor Bronze |
Maximum Wire Size AWG | 22AWG |
Maximum Contact Resistance | 20mΩ |
Minimum Operating Temperature | -25°C |
Maximum Current | 3A |
Maximum Operating Temperature | +85°C |
